Auburn railway station is about 0.4 km away, providing frequent services on the Western and Leppington & Inner West lines of the Sydney Trains network.
Busways operates routes 540 (to Silverwater Correctional Complex) and 544 (to Macquarie Centre), while Transit Systems runs routes 908, 909, 911 and S3, connecting the area to surrounding suburbs and the Auburn Botanical Gardens.
Auburn Park is just 0.2–0.3 km away and Railway Park is roughly 0.3 km from the property, providing nearby green spaces for leisure and exercise.
Heritage‑listed sites nearby include the Auburn Railway Signal Box (about 0.5 km away) and Electricity Substation No. 167 (approximately 0.7 km away).
Auburn is located roughly 16 km west of Sydney’s CBD, making the suburb a convenient location for commuting to the city.
A commercial strip close to the railway station stretches about 1 km and offers a variety of multicultural restaurants, cafés and shops, reflecting Auburn’s diverse community.
